Abstract
In the framework of reducing the impact of the electric system infrastructure, the paper presents the successful field application of the principle of active shielding of the magnetic field of HV overhead lines. Two plants have been deployed and are currently being operated since some years on a 132kV and a 400kV line. The solution to be used locally, where sensible targets exist or where it is hard to find free paths for new lines, minimizes the impact on the line structure. Two different control system solutions have been studied and applied to avoid any impact on the normal operation of the line. Both systems have been continuously operated for some years and have assured to keep the magnetic field at the sensible targets below the desired limits.
